First Aid Kits In The Home -
Whether your home is big or small, it’s critical to keep a well stocked first aid kit in an easy-to-access place in the home. You can purchase a kit through a Brisbane first aid supplier; once you have one, let everyone in the house know precisely where you plan on keeping it. With many accidents, even fractions of a second can make a difference; the more time it takes for someone to find the required supplies, the higher the risk of a serious injury or a life threatening complication. Don’t put the health and safety of the people in your home at risk: keep a first aid keep somewhere safe and sound.

First Aid Kits In The Workplace -
Work-related injuries are a very serious and real problem. Even if you work in a seemingly safe office environment, mishaps happen all the time. It’s very smart to keep at least a couple of first aid kits in a few strategically placed – and well advertised – locations in the office. For this reason, regardless of where an accident may occur, all employees should know exactly where they can locate the required supplies. By being prepared, appropriate action can be taken resulting with a far less stressful incident.
